Zawory elektromagnetyczne 2/2-drożne bezpośredniego działania do pary
Typu EV215B
EV215B to 2/2-drożny elektrozawór bezpośredniego działania do pary wodnej o temperaturze do
185 °C.
Uszczelnienie teflonowe PTFE zapewnia niezawodną pracę nawet w przypadku pary zanieczyszczonej.
Korpus wykonany ze stali nierdzewnej gwarantuje długą oraz bezawaryjną pracę.
